Abstract  Abstract

PURPOSE: A soft handover method for an MBMS(Multimedia Broadcast/Multicast Service) in a CDMA mobile communication system is provided to soft-combine data received from many base stations in order to lower transmission power of the base stations thereby efficiently using power. CONSTITUTION: An RNC measures a CPICH(Common Pilot Channel) for a UE(501). The UE measures a CPICH SIR value and transmits the measured CPICH SIR value to the RNC(502). The RNC performs a node synchronization procedure(503). The RNC transmits a measurement control RRC message to the UE(504). The UE transmits a time difference between measured SFNs to the RNC(505). The RNC transmits a calculated MBMS offset value to a node B(507). The node B transmits a radio link setup response message to the RNC(508). The RNC informs the UE of a decided MBMS offset value(509). The UE transmits a radio bearer setup complete message to the RNC(510). A synchronization procedure is carried out between the RNC and the node B(511).
